Quote:
Originally Posted by 1hitter View Post
Hey BF, Looks like you are trying floros this time for side growth? How do the buds compare are they light and fluffy or heavy and dense? Keep up the led grow one of these days I want to try one too.
thanx 1 hitter. The buds are as dense as any hid grown- not as big, and thats the point, for right now this is a micro-tek. These lights are no where near ready for cash croppers.But for the small home-grower they just have too many advantages over hid.One is NOT penetration.The 1w diodes just cant compare to the intense penetrating power of hid, but for the micro-grower that has about 2-3 feet of height to deal with thats not a problem.

Quote:
Originally Posted by DixieHicky View Post
I got the 90w GrowUFO mostly because I was ignorant...and afraid of Big Hairy HPS...so now Im stuck with it. Im told it will do fine for veg, but not for flowering. Is this so? I tried to send it back...saying it wouldnt grow tomatoes...but the rep assured me he had grown MANY tomatoes, LOL. What could I say? I am only just now starting my seeds, so I have nothing to really report, so far. Im just wondering what to expect? FWIW,I have 10 seedlings in 16 oz cups under the UFO.

What should I expect?

Dixie
No worries, your plants will grow just fine. Can you give a little more info? Are they feminized seeds? What variety? Check the specs on your ufo- does it have 660nm red diodes-call the guy that sold it to ya-if he dosent know, inform him that he should probably find out for ya.660 nm reds are required for flowering, you've probably heard the bad press on ufo's made with 620-630nm diodes.Think of nm(nanometers) as color temp-indication-2700k fluoros-flowering 6500k-veg so thinking along those lines- 630nm-growth/ 660nm-flowering.If your ufo does not have the required diodes-supplementation with some 2700k(flowering) fluorescent light-will do the trick.
